To connect multiple guitar pedals in a pedalboard setup, use patch cables to connect the output of one pedal to the input of the next pedal. Arrange the pedals in the order you want the signal to flow, typically starting with the tuner pedal first, followed by distortion, modulation, and time-based effects. Use a power supply to provide power to all the pedals on the board.

The most important pedals for guitar players to have on their pedalboard are typically a tuner, overdrive/distortion, delay, and reverb. These pedals help shape the tone and sound of the guitar, allowing for a wide range of effects and versatility in playing.
Kim Thayil, the guitarist of Soundgarden, uses a variety of pedals on his pedalboard, including the Electro-Harmonix Big Muff distortion pedal and the Dunlop Cry Baby wah pedal.
Multi-effect guitar pedals offer the advantage of convenience and space-saving, as they combine multiple effects into one unit. They also provide preset combinations of effects for easy use and can be more cost-effective than buying individual pedals.

The Behringer PB 1000 can power multiple pedals, but it has a limited number of outputs. It may not be able to power all pedals simultaneously if you have a large pedalboard with many pedals. Review the power requirements of your pedals and ensure they are compatible with the PB 1000.
